Is Pregnancy Massage Safe? A Gentle Guide for Mothers-to-Be

Pregnancy brings many changes to the body. As your baby grows, it is completely normal to experience back pain, tired legs, swollen feet, muscle tension, and general discomfort. Because of this, many expectant mothers consider booking a pregnancy massage to help them feel more comfortable.

One of the first questions that usually comes to mind, however, is whether pregnancy massage is actually safe.

The good news is that pregnancy massage is generally considered safe for most women when it is performed by a qualified therapist who understands how to adapt the treatment for pregnancy. In fact, many women find that it becomes one of the most relaxing and beneficial forms of self-care during pregnancy.

That said, pregnancy is a unique journey, and there are certain situations where extra caution may be needed. Understanding how pregnancy massage works and when it may or may not be appropriate can help you make an informed decision.

What Is a Pregnancy Massage?

A pregnancy massage, sometimes called a prenatal massage, is a massage treatment specifically adapted for pregnant women.

Unlike a standard massage, the treatment is designed to accommodate the physical changes that occur during pregnancy. Special attention is given to positioning, comfort, and the amount of pressure used throughout the session.

The goal is not simply relaxation. Pregnancy massage is intended to help relieve some of the common discomforts associated with pregnancy while providing a safe and nurturing experience for the mother.

As the body changes to support a growing baby, muscles and joints are placed under additional strain. Pregnancy massage aims to help reduce that strain while allowing mothers-to-be an opportunity to relax and unwind.

Why Do Pregnant Women Consider Massage?

Pregnancy can be a wonderful experience, but it can also be physically demanding.

Many women experience aches and pains that were not present before pregnancy. The growing baby changes posture, shifts weight distribution, and places additional pressure on muscles and joints.

Common reasons women seek pregnancy massage include:

  • Back pain and discomfort
  • Neck and shoulder tension
  • Swollen feet and legs
  • General muscle fatigue
  • Stress and anxiety during pregnancy

While every pregnancy is different, these concerns are extremely common and often become more noticeable as pregnancy progresses.

For many women, massage provides a welcome opportunity to relax while receiving support for some of these physical challenges.

Is Pregnancy Massage Actually Safe?

For most healthy pregnancies, pregnancy massage is generally considered safe when performed by a trained professional.

The key word here is “qualified.”

Pregnancy massage is not simply a regular massage with a different name. Therapists who offer prenatal treatments should understand how pregnancy affects the body and how the treatment needs to be adjusted accordingly.

Proper positioning is particularly important. As pregnancy progresses, lying flat on the stomach becomes impossible and lying flat on the back for extended periods may not be comfortable or advisable for some women.

A qualified therapist will use appropriate positioning techniques to ensure both comfort and safety throughout the session.

For most women with uncomplicated pregnancies, pregnancy massage can be enjoyed safely and comfortably.

When Should You Speak to Your Healthcare Provider First?

Although pregnancy massage is generally safe, there are situations where additional medical guidance may be appropriate.

If you have a high-risk pregnancy or any pregnancy-related complications, it is always wise to discuss massage with your healthcare provider before booking a treatment.

This is particularly important if there are concerns relating to your pregnancy or if your doctor has advised additional monitoring or restrictions.

Every pregnancy is unique. What is appropriate for one person may not necessarily be appropriate for another.

Seeking professional medical advice can provide reassurance and help you determine whether massage is suitable for your circumstances.

How Is Pregnancy Massage Different From a Regular Massage?

One of the biggest differences is the way the treatment is adapted to support the changing body.

Pregnancy massage focuses on comfort and safety while still providing the benefits of therapeutic touch.

The therapist may adjust:

  • Positioning during the session
  • Pressure used during treatment
  • Areas receiving particular attention
  • Treatment techniques to suit pregnancy

These adjustments allow the massage to remain both comfortable and appropriate for expectant mothers.

The overall experience often feels gentler than some other massage styles, but it can still be highly effective for relieving tension and promoting relaxation.

What Are the Potential Benefits of Pregnancy Massage?

Many women choose pregnancy massage because it helps them feel more comfortable as their pregnancy progresses.

One of the most commonly reported benefits is reduced muscle tension. Areas such as the lower back, hips, shoulders, and legs often work harder during pregnancy and may become tight or uncomfortable.

Massage may help ease some of this tension while promoting a greater sense of physical comfort.

Many women also appreciate the opportunity to slow down and focus on themselves for a while. Pregnancy often involves preparing for a new arrival, attending appointments, and managing daily responsibilities. A massage session can provide valuable time for relaxation and self-care.

Some women also find that massage helps them feel calmer and less stressed, which can contribute to an overall sense of wellbeing during pregnancy.

Which Stage of Pregnancy Is Best for Massage?

This is one of the most common questions expectant mothers ask.

There is no single answer because every pregnancy is different.

Many women enjoy pregnancy massage during the second and third trimesters when physical discomfort often becomes more noticeable. As the baby grows, pressure on the lower back, hips, and legs may increase, making massage particularly appealing.

Some providers may have their own policies regarding when pregnancy massage is offered, so it is always worth discussing your stage of pregnancy when making a booking.

The most important consideration is ensuring that the treatment is adapted appropriately for your individual needs.

Can Pregnancy Massage Help with Back Pain?

Back pain is one of the most common reasons women seek pregnancy massage.

As pregnancy progresses, the body’s centre of gravity shifts, placing additional strain on the lower back and surrounding muscles.

This can lead to discomfort that ranges from mild to quite significant.

While massage is not a cure for back pain, many women find that it helps relieve muscle tension and improves overall comfort.

A therapist can focus on areas that feel particularly tight while adapting the treatment to ensure comfort throughout the session.

What About Swollen Feet and Legs?

Swelling is another common concern during pregnancy.

Many women notice that their feet and legs feel heavier or more swollen as the day progresses.

Gentle massage techniques may help promote comfort and relaxation in these areas. However, any sudden or unusual swelling should always be discussed with a healthcare provider.

The goal of pregnancy massage is not to diagnose or treat medical conditions but rather to support comfort and wellbeing during pregnancy.

Can Pregnancy Massage Help Reduce Stress?

Pregnancy can bring excitement, anticipation, and happiness, but it can also come with worries and emotional ups and downs.

Many expectant mothers find that massage provides a valuable opportunity to slow down and focus on themselves.

The calming environment, gentle treatment, and dedicated relaxation time can help create a sense of peace and balance.

For some women, this emotional benefit is just as valuable as the physical relief that massage provides.

Feeling cared for and supported during pregnancy can have a meaningful impact on overall wellbeing.

Choosing the Right Pregnancy Massage Therapist

Not all massage therapists offer prenatal massage, which is why it is important to choose someone with relevant experience.

A qualified pregnancy massage therapist should understand how pregnancy affects the body and how treatments should be adapted accordingly.

Before booking, it is perfectly reasonable to ask questions about the therapist’s experience and approach to pregnancy massage.

Feeling comfortable and confident in your therapist is an important part of the overall experience.

A good therapist will be happy to discuss your concerns and explain how the treatment will be tailored to your needs.

How to Know If Pregnancy Massage Is Right for You

For many women, pregnancy massage can be a wonderful addition to their self-care routine.

If you are experiencing muscle tension, discomfort, stress, or simply feel that your body needs a little extra care, massage may be worth considering.

The most important step is ensuring that the treatment is appropriate for your pregnancy and that it is performed by a qualified professional.

Listening to your body, discussing any concerns with your healthcare provider when necessary, and choosing an experienced therapist can help you enjoy the experience with confidence.

Final Thoughts

Pregnancy massage is generally considered safe for most women with healthy pregnancies when performed by a qualified therapist who understands prenatal care.

The treatment is specifically adapted to support the changing needs of expectant mothers and may help relieve common pregnancy-related discomforts such as muscle tension, back pain, and stress.

Every pregnancy is different, which is why it is always important to choose a therapist with appropriate experience and seek medical guidance when necessary.

For many mothers-to-be, pregnancy massage becomes more than just a treatment. It becomes an opportunity to relax, recharge, and enjoy a little extra care during one of life’s most important journeys.
